Percutaneous endoscopic transpedicular approach for high-grade down-migrated lumbar disc herniations
Javier Quillo-Olvera1, Kutbuddin Akbary1, Jin-Sung Kim2
1Spine Center, Department of Neurosurgery and The Catholic Central Laboratory of Surgery (CCLS), Seoul St. Mary's Hospital, College of Medicine, The Catholic University of Korea, 222 Banpo Daero, Seocho-gu, Seoul, 137-701, South Korea.
A novel transpedicular endoscopic approach offers a safe and effective surgical option for removing high-grade down-migrated lumbar disc herniations. This minimally invasive technique avoids extensive laminectomy and facetectomy, preserving spinal stability.

Background:
- High-grade down-migrated lumbar disc herniations medial to the pedicle traditionally require extensive laminectomy and facetectomy.
- These extensive procedures carry risks of iatrogenic spinal instability.
Purpose of the Study:
- To evaluate the feasibility and effectiveness of a direct percutaneous endoscopic transpedicular approach for treating down-migrated lumbar disc herniations.
- To offer an alternative surgical technique that minimizes spinal instability.
Main Methods:
- A transpedicular approach was utilized, involving the creation of a tunnel through the pedicle.
- Access to the parapedicular epidural space was achieved through this tunnel.
- Herniated disc material was removed via endoscopic visualization.
Main Results:
- The transpedicular endoscopic technique successfully accessed herniated discs located medially to the pedicle.
- The procedure allowed for safe and effective removal of the migrated disc fragments.
- This approach avoids the need for extensive bone resection, mitigating risks of instability.
Conclusions:
- The percutaneous endoscopic transpedicular approach is a feasible and effective surgical option for down-migrated lumbar disc herniations.
- This technique provides a safe alternative to traditional open surgeries, preserving spinal stability.
